SkipTheDishes announces seasoned executive Paul Burns as new CEO

Retrieved on: 
Tuesday, December 5, 2023

Burns, former managing director at X, to succeed interim CEO Steve Puchala in driving Canada's homegrown delivery network forward

Key Points: 
  • Burns, former managing director at X, to succeed interim CEO Steve Puchala in driving Canada's homegrown delivery network forward
    WINNIPEG, MB, Dec. 5, 2023 /CNW/ - Today, SkipTheDishes, Canada's homegrown delivery network, announced that Paul Burns, most recently the managing director at X (formerly known as Twitter), has been named the company's new Chief Executive Officer.
  • Burns will be succeeding interim CEO Steve Puchala, who stepped into the role earlier this year following former CEO Howard Migdal's appointment to Executive Vice President, North America and CEO of Grubhub, within the Just Eat Takeaway.com network, in April 2023.
  • "Having witnessed Skip's incredible rise from a Prairies start-up in 2012 to the industry-leading organization it is today, I am honoured to be stepping into the position of CEO and working with a very talented team to create more transformative delivery experiences for Canadians," says Paul Burns, Chief Executive Officer, SkipTheDishes.
  • With Burns' transition to CEO, Interim CEO Steve Puchala will be retiring at the end of the year.

Food Banks Canada and SkipTheDishes join forces for their Fourth Annual Winter Charity Campaign, Give and Take(Out)

Retrieved on: 
Tuesday, November 21, 2023

"With food banks visits in 2023 surpassing the highest levels in Canadian history, initiatives such as our annual Winter Charity campaign with SkipTheDishes are more important than ever before," says Kirstin Beardsley, CEO of Food Banks Canada.

Key Points: 
  • "With food banks visits in 2023 surpassing the highest levels in Canadian history, initiatives such as our annual Winter Charity campaign with SkipTheDishes are more important than ever before," says Kirstin Beardsley, CEO of Food Banks Canada.
  • This is Skip's fourth consecutive year working with Food Banks Canada on their Winter Charity Campaign, which has provided more than 4.7 million meals across Canada, as well as weekly food donations from Skip Express Lane store locations to local food banks across the country.
  • Both organizations continue to share the common goal of creating immediate and long-term solutions to combat food insecurity:
    Visits to food banks have increased by 78.5 per cent since 2019.
  • In March 2023 alone, there was almost 2 million visits to food banks in Canada.
